Smart amounts and timing you can trust


Now, let’s cover smart amounts. I keep apple pectin detox gentle and intentional. Start low, then adjust slowly. For powder, start with 1/4 to 1/2 teaspoon once daily for several days. Next, increase to 1 teaspoon once or twice daily, only if your digestion feels comfortable. For capsules, follow the label. I pair any form with extra water, since fiber loves fluid. With whole apples, I plan one to two crisp apples per day with balanced meals. Moreover, I listen to my body. If you feel gassy or tight, step back, hydrate, and wait a day before changing anything.


Timing matters as much as the amount. I like powder in a morning smoothie or stirred into afternoon yogurt. Capsules fit mid-morning or mid-afternoon, away from supplements you want to absorb well. Whole apples shine as a snack 60–90 minutes before dinner. Consequently, I avoid stacking many fiber sources at once. Instead, I space them across the day for steady comfort. Description

A calm, fiber-forward apple pectin detox smoothie that supports fullness and routine. You’ll blend gentle apple pectin with creamy yogurt, apple, oats, and cinnamon for a steady start to the day.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 small crisp apple, cored and chopped
  • 1/2 cup plain yogurt (or dairy-free)
  • 1/3 cup rolled oats
  • 1 teaspoon apple pectin powder (start with 1/2 tsp if new)
  • 3/41 cup water (or milk of choice)
  • 1 teaspoon honey or maple syrup (optional)
  • 1/4 teaspoon cinnamon 3–4 ice cubes

Instructions

  1. Add yogurt, water, oats, apple pectin, and cinnamon to a blender.
  2. Add chopped apple, sweetener if using, and ice.
  3. Blend until smooth and creamy, 30–45 seconds.
  4. Taste, then adjust thickness with a splash of water.
  5. Pour into a glass and drink slowly with extra water nearby.

Notes

Start with 1/2 teaspoon pectin if you’re new, then increase only if comfortable.

Space this smoothie several hours away from supplements or medicines you want to absorb well.

Pair with a protein-rich snack later if you feel hungry mid-morning.

For a warm option, skip ice and use slightly warm milk for a cozy sip.

Side effects, interactions, and smart precautions


Now, let’s talk about side effects. Any fiber change can cause bloating, gas, or cramping if you jump too fast. So scale apple pectin detox slowly, sip extra water, and space doses. If you notice discomfort, reduce by half, then reassess in two or three days. Also, fiber may affect how your body handles certain supplements or medicines when taken together. Therefore, separate apple pectin detox from critical pills by several hours. If you live with a sensitive gut, discuss your plan with a healthcare professional first. Pregnant and nursing folks should do the same.

FAQs (based on your questions)

What are the side effects of taking apple pectin?

Apple pectin detox can trigger gas, bloating, or cramps when you increase too fast. Therefore, start low, add water, and space doses. If discomfort shows up, reduce by half and reassess after a day or two. If you take medicines or have a sensitive gut, talk with your healthcare professional first.

Can apple pectin help you lose weight?

Apple pectin detox supports fullness and steadier snacking. Therefore, you may eat fewer impulsive bites and feel more satisfied. However, weight change depends on your overall pattern: portions, protein, movement, sleep, and stress. Use apple pectin as one helpful tool inside a balanced routine.

Does apple pectin remove heavy metals?

Apple pectin binds certain substances in the gut. However, the real-world impact varies. You still need a balanced diet, hydration, and medical guidance when appropriate. If heavy metal exposure concerns you, consult a qualified professional for testing and a personalized plan.

How much apple pectin should I take daily?

For most adults starting an apple pectin detox, begin with 1/4–1/2 tsp powder once daily, then increase to about 1 tsp once or twice daily only if comfortable. For capsules, follow the label. With whole apples, plan 1–2 per day. Always drink extra water and adjust slowly.
